Qualities to Look for in a Tutor

When selecting a tutor, it is important to consider certain qualities that can contribute to their effectiveness in helping students achieve their language goals. Here are some key qualities to look for:

  1. Expertise: A tutor should have a strong command of the English language and possess in-depth knowledge of grammar, vocabulary, and pronunciation. They should be able to explain complex concepts in a clear and concise manner.

  2. Patience: Learning a new language can be challenging and frustrating at times. A good tutor should be patient and understanding, providing support and encouragement to their students as they navigate the learning process.

  3. Flexibility: Each student has unique learning needs and preferences. A tutor should be adaptable and able to adjust their teaching methods to accommodate different learning styles and pace.

  4. Communication Skills: Effective communication is essential for a tutor to establish rapport with their students. They should be able to listen actively, ask questions, and provide constructive feedback to facilitate learning.

  5. Passion for Teaching: A tutor who is passionate about teaching and genuinely cares about their students’ progress is more likely to inspire and motivate them to succeed.

  6. Cultural Sensitivity: English language learners come from diverse cultural backgrounds. A tutor should be sensitive to cultural differences and create an inclusive learning environment that respects and celebrates diversity.

By considering these qualities when selecting a tutor, you can ensure that you find someone who is not only knowledgeable and skilled but also capable of fostering a positive and effective learning experience.

Screening and Selecting Potential Tutors

When it comes to screening and selecting potential tutors, it is crucial to find individuals who possess the right qualifications and skills to effectively teach English language learners. This process ensures that the tutors are capable of providing the necessary support and guidance to help students improve their language proficiency. Here are some key steps to consider when screening and selecting potential tutors:

Conducting interviews and assessing qualifications

The first step in the screening process is to conduct interviews with potential tutors. This allows you to assess their qualifications and determine if they have the necessary knowledge and experience to teach English. During the interview, you can ask questions about their educational background, teaching experience, and familiarity with different teaching methods. It is important to evaluate their communication skills and their ability to adapt their teaching style to meet the needs of individual students.

Evaluating teaching experience and language proficiency

In addition to interviews, it is essential to evaluate the teaching experience of potential tutors. This can be done by reviewing their resumes and contacting their previous employers or clients for references. By doing so, you can gain insights into their teaching methods, classroom management skills, and ability to engage students effectively. Furthermore, assessing their language proficiency is crucial, as tutors need to have a strong command of the English language to effectively teach it to others.

Checking references and conducting background checks

To ensure the safety and well-being of students, it is important to check references and conduct background checks on potential tutors. Contacting their references allows you to gain valuable insights into their teaching abilities, professionalism, and reliability. Additionally, conducting background checks helps to verify their credentials and ensure that they have no criminal record or history of misconduct. This step is crucial in maintaining a safe and secure learning environment for students.

Monitoring and Evaluating Tutor Performance

As an organization or institution that provides tutoring services, it is crucial to monitor and evaluate the performance of your tutors. This ensures that they are delivering high-quality instruction and meeting the needs of the English language learners they are working with. By implementing effective monitoring and evaluation strategies, you can identify areas for improvement, provide feedback, and ultimately enhance the overall effectiveness of your tutoring program.

Implementing regular performance evaluations

Regular performance evaluations are essential for assessing the effectiveness of your tutors. These evaluations should be conducted at predetermined intervals, such as quarterly or annually, to provide a comprehensive overview of their performance. During these evaluations, consider the following factors:

  1. Teaching effectiveness: Evaluate how well tutors are delivering instruction and engaging students. Are they using effective teaching strategies? Are they able to explain concepts clearly and concisely? Assess their ability to adapt their teaching style to meet the individual needs of each student.

  2. Knowledge of subject matter: Assess the tutors’ knowledge and understanding of the English language. Do they have a strong grasp of grammar, vocabulary, and pronunciation? Are they up to date with the latest teaching methodologies and resources? A well-rounded understanding of the subject matter is crucial for effective tutoring.

  3. Communication skills: Evaluate the tutors’ communication skills, both verbal and non-verbal. Are they able to effectively communicate with students, parents, and colleagues? Do they actively listen and respond to questions and concerns? Strong communication skills are essential for building rapport and creating a positive learning environment.

Collecting feedback from students and parents

In addition to formal performance evaluations, it is important to collect feedback from the students and parents who are directly involved in the tutoring program. Their insights can provide valuable information about the tutors’ effectiveness and areas for improvement. Consider the following methods for collecting feedback:

  1. Surveys: Create surveys that allow students and parents to provide anonymous feedback about their experience with the tutor. Ask specific questions about the tutor’s teaching style, communication skills, and overall effectiveness. This feedback can help identify areas of strength and areas that need improvement.

  2. Open communication channels: Encourage students and parents to communicate openly with the tutors. Provide a platform for them to share their thoughts, concerns, and suggestions. This can be done through regular check-ins, email communication, or online discussion forums. Actively listen to their feedback and address any issues or concerns promptly.

  3. Parent-teacher conferences: Organize regular parent-teacher conferences to discuss the progress of the students and gather feedback from parents. This face-to-face interaction allows for a more in-depth discussion about the tutor’s performance and the overall effectiveness of the tutoring program.

Addressing any issues or concerns promptly

When monitoring and evaluating tutor performance, it is important to address any issues or concerns promptly. This demonstrates your commitment to providing high-quality tutoring services and ensures that students are receiving the support they need. Consider the following steps:

  1. Open and honest communication: Maintain open lines of communication with tutors and encourage them to share any challenges or concerns they may be facing. Actively listen to their feedback and provide guidance and support as needed.

  2. Professional development opportunities: Identify areas where tutors may need additional training or support. Offer professional development opportunities to enhance their skills and knowledge. This could include workshops, webinars, or access to educational resources.

  3. Performance improvement plans: If a tutor’s performance consistently falls below expectations, develop a performance improvement plan. This plan should outline specific areas for improvement, along with clear goals and timelines. Provide ongoing support and guidance to help the tutor meet these goals.

Retaining and Motivating Tutors

Retaining and motivating tutors is crucial for the success of any English language tutoring program. When tutors feel valued and supported, they are more likely to stay committed and provide high-quality instruction to their students. In this section, we will explore some strategies to retain and motivate tutors.

Recognizing and rewarding exceptional performance

Recognizing and rewarding exceptional performance is an effective way to motivate tutors. By acknowledging their hard work and dedication, tutors feel appreciated and valued. This can be done through various means, such as:

  1. Performance-based incentives: Offering financial incentives or bonuses based on tutor performance can be a great motivator. For example, tutors who consistently receive positive feedback from students and parents or achieve specific goals can be rewarded with monetary bonuses.

  2. Public recognition: Acknowledging tutors’ achievements publicly can boost their morale and motivation. This can be done through newsletters, social media posts, or staff meetings where tutors are praised for their outstanding work.

  3. Certificates and awards: Presenting tutors with certificates or awards for their contributions can be a tangible way to recognize their efforts. These can be given out annually or on special occasions to celebrate their accomplishments.

Providing opportunities for career growth and advancement

Tutors who see a clear path for career growth and advancement are more likely to stay motivated and committed to their role. Here are some ways to provide such opportunities:

  1. Professional development programs: Offering ongoing training and development programs can help tutors enhance their skills and knowledge. This can include workshops, webinars, or conferences focused on English language teaching techniques, classroom management, or other relevant topics.

  2. Mentorship programs: Pairing experienced tutors with new or less experienced tutors can create a supportive learning environment. Mentors can provide guidance, share best practices, and help tutors navigate challenges they may face in their role.

  3. Promotion opportunities: Creating a clear promotion structure within the tutoring program can give tutors something to strive for. This can include positions such as lead tutor, curriculum developer, or supervisor, which come with increased responsibilities and higher compensation.

Creating a sense of community and belonging

Building a sense of community and belonging among tutors can foster a positive and supportive work environment. When tutors feel connected to their peers and the organization, they are more likely to stay engaged and motivated. Here are some ways to create this sense of community:

  1. Regular team meetings: Holding regular team meetings allows tutors to connect, share experiences, and learn from one another. These meetings can be used to discuss challenges, brainstorm ideas, and celebrate successes.

  2. Social events: Organizing social events, such as team-building activities or holiday parties, can help tutors bond and build relationships outside of the tutoring sessions. This can create a sense of camaraderie and strengthen the team dynamic.

  3. Communication channels: Providing tutors with a platform to communicate and collaborate, such as a dedicated online forum or group chat, can facilitate knowledge sharing and support. Tutors can ask questions, share resources, and seek advice from their peers.
